First of all, their cultural background.
The culture of Vietnam has undergone changes over the millennia with a history of long warfare.
The first Chinese domination of Vietnam lasting over a millennium that bring Chinese influences onto
Vietnamese culture. During the French colonial period in the mid-19th century, Vietnamese culture
absorbed European influences. Most Vietnamese, regardless of religious denomination, practice
ancestor worship.

Majority of VNese cultural values are rooted from Confucianism which is respect for education,
fam and elder, and Taoism which is desire to avoid conflicts and achieve harmony
